The ideal solar installer is seldom the most inexpensive quote

Price matters, and any individual that says otherwise is not being straightforward. However the most affordable quote typically hides one of 3 problems: under-sized systems, lower-tier devices, or weak post-install support. I have seen proposals where the panel matter looked reputable until you contrasted estimated annual manufacturing to the home's real usage. The consumer assumed they were acquiring energy self-reliance and ended up balancing out much less than expected.

The stronger installers often tend to be clear regarding trade-offs. They will inform you, for example, that a much more effective panel might aid if roof room is tight, yet might not deserve the costs on a broad, unshaded roofing. They will certainly discuss when a main inverter makes good sense, and when microinverters or power optimizers are much better because of shade, orientation modifications, or monitoring preferences. That type of conversation is a great indication. It shows the company is designing a system, not simply selling a package.

A useful quote must reveal system dimension in kilowatts, estimated yearly manufacturing in kilowatt-hours, equipment brand names and version lines, placing type, guarantee details, anticipated timeline, and a clear breakdown of total expense. If you can not contrast proposals line by line, the pricing quote process is currently failing you.

Start with the roofing system, not the brochure

Many solar jobs fail silently at the roof stage. The sales discussion focuses on savings, while the real setup depends upon whether the roofing appropriates for 20 plus years of service. If your roof is nearing completion of its life, solar ought to not go on very first unless you are prepared to pay to eliminate and re-install it later.

In Tracy, floor tile roofing systems and tile roofs are both common, and each includes its own setup factors to consider. Floor tile roof coverings can definitely sustain solar, but the installer must recognize exactly how to install appropriately, stay clear of unneeded damage, and keep waterproofing stability. Shingle roofs are typically a lot more straightforward, but roof age still matters. A good service provider will say so clearly, even if it takes the chance of postponing the sale.

This is among those areas where experience programs. Experienced installers do not speak about roofing as a second thought. They ask concerns concerning age, repair work, and prior leakages. If there is any kind of uncertainty, they generate a contractor or advise dealing with the roof covering first. That may really feel bothersome, however it is far much better than finding five years later that a roof covering concern has become a solar concern and neither service provider wishes to take responsibility.

Understanding the price quote, not just the monthly payment

One of the most convenient means to get sidetracked throughout a solar acquisition is to focus only on the repayment. That is specifically real when a quote is mounted as "less than your energy bill." It seems compelling, however it can obscure the real math.

A house owner in Tracy could obtain 2 propositions with comparable month-to-month payments, yet one includes a bigger system, much better surveillance, and stronger service warranty coverage. Another might extend the funding term, bury dealer charges in the financing, or presume even more costs countered than the system is likely to provide. This is why the total mounted expense, financing framework, rate of interest, and manufacturing approximate all deserve scrutiny.

If you prepare to remain in the home for a long time and can pay cash, that typically offers the cleanest economics. If you favor funding, examine the principal, the car loan term, and whether a lower price features substantial ahead of time costs baked right into the agreement. If a lease or power acquisition arrangement is on the table, ask just how transfer works if you offer your house, exactly how annual escalators impact your lasting repayment, and what options exist at the end of the term. There is no globally ideal option, however there are options that fit specific homes much better than others.

Equipment top quality is about fit, not status alone

Homeowners commonly obtain pulled into brand name contrasts without enough context. Yes, panel and inverter producers matter. A secure firm with a solid warranty record and dependable support deserves taking note of. However one of the most pricey panel is not automatically the very best selection for every home.

If your roof has wide, unhampered aircrafts with superb sunlight exposure, you may not require the highest performance module on the marketplace. If your roof has multiple aspects, recurring shade, or you worth panel-level surveillance, microinverters or optimizers may supply practical advantages. If backup power issues during outages, battery layout and crucial load planning become part of the conversation.

A mindful installer will describe not simply what they sell, but why it fits your home. That may include trade-offs like these: premium panels can help take full advantage of result on limited roofing area, while mid-tier panels may use better value on larger roofings; microinverters can streamline monitoring and alleviate some shading losses, while string inverter systems might cost much less in uncomplicated designs; batteries add durability and can boost time-based power usage, yet they likewise add substantial cost and need realistic expectations regarding what they can power.

Batteries in Tracy, when they make good sense and when they do not

Battery storage is worthy of a cautious, non-ideological conversation. Some homeowners want backup power during blackouts. Others are extra focused on moving use far from pricey utility durations. Some simply want the cleanest feasible power account for the house. Those are all legitimate motivations, however batteries are not affordable, and they are not one dimension fits all.

For a home that functions from home, shops chilled medication, or can not tolerate downtime for web and vital circuits, a battery can provide genuine comfort. For a house owner that mostly desires the fastest payback and rarely experiences significant failures, the numbers might be tougher to warrant. The right installer needs to fit claiming both things, depending on the situation.

If a battery is proposed, ask what loads it will certainly support, for the length of time under normal use, whether entire home backup is practical or partial back-up, and just how the battery incorporates with the planetary system. Those information matter a lot more than the headline capacity number alone.

Reviews matter, however read them like a contractor would

Online testimonials are useful, though not in the simplistic way many people utilize them. A long touch of ideal five-star remarks with little information is much less valuable than a mix of reactions that describe the actual process. Try to find mentions of communication, timetable adherence, cleaning, post-install support, and exactly how the firm handled a hiccup. Virtually every construction-related business strikes a grab at some point. What matters is how they respond.

Pay special interest to reviews created six months or a year after installment. Immediate post-install reviews typically show enjoyment and alleviation that the job is done. Later on reviews disclose whether tracking functioned, assistance phone calls were returned, and promises stood up when the sales cycle ended.
